Subheading 1b Economic, social and territorial cohesion 2018 commitment appropriations

Subheading 1b covers EU expenditure on cohesion policy and supports harmonious economic, social and territorial development of EU regions and cities. Most of the expenditure in the subheading is pre-allocated to the Member States and implemented through three European structural and investment (ESI) funds, namely the European Regional Development Fund (ERDF), the European Social Fund (ESF) and the Cohesion Fund (CF). The resources of these three funds, which include a specific contribution from the CF to the Connecting Europe Facility, are distributed between two objectives: ‘Investment for growth and jobs’ and ‘European territorial cooperation’. The ESI funds make a significant contribution to initiatives directly and indirectly supporting industrial policy objectives (see Box 2 above). In addition, subheading 1b has a specific allocation for the Youth Employment Initiative.
